Three-year-old boy latest fatality victim on our roads

A three-year-old child is believed to be the country’s latest road fatality following a motor vehicle accident in Lautoka last night.

Police spokesperson Ana Naisoro said the victim was crossing with his mother when he was allegedly bumped by a van driven by a 45-year-old man who allegedly failed to stop following the accident.

“The suspect was pursued by another vehicle up to the Lautoka Police Station where he surrendered himself to Police,” Ms Naisoro said.

She said the alleged incident occurred along Sukanaivalu Road.

Meanwhile the road death toll currently stands at 24 compared to 38 for the same period last year.
